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To eliminate the inability of discharging large current at low temperature and to prevent the deterioration of a battery that is left unused for a long time. SOLUTION: This power supply has a cell-temperature detecting means 5. If the cell temperature is equal to or lower than a specified temperature when the cell discharges a current to an external host appliance, preliminary discharging or preliminary charging or preliminary charging and discharging is repeated between a main battery pack 1 and an auxiliary battery pack 6 through a DC-DC converter 10 until the cell temperature exceeds a specified value or internal impedance becomes a specified value or lower than it, before the discharging to the appliance is started. Also, a means is provided for measuring the elapsed time of the charging or discharging. By setting a specified value based on the average value of temperatures during the measurement of the elapsed time, the preliminary discharging or preliminary charging or preliminary charging and discharging is performed if the elapsed time is equal to or longer than the specified value or if the temperature during the measurement of the elapsed time is equal to or higher than the specified value and continues for a specified period of time.

Description of the Related Art A battery pack contains a plurality of cells (secondary batteries) and is used as a power source for portable electronic devices such as mobile phones, notebook computers, players, and digital cameras. It is used in various electric devices, from small-capacity devices to large-capacity devices used as power sources for electric vehicles. A large current flows through various types of electric equipment during normal startup, and particularly in the case of an electric vehicle, a large current is required in a short time of several seconds at the time of starting. Therefore, as a countermeasure, it is possible to connect a super capacitor to each cell in parallel, but this is not sufficient. For example, when the battery pack is discharged at a low temperature of -5 ° C or lower, if the discharge current is large, the internal impedance of the battery is large.

In addition, if a battery is left for a long time without charging / discharging, an inert substance is generated and deteriorates. The higher the temperature, the more severe the deterioration, and the closer the battery is to a fully charged state, the more severe the deterioration.

When the main battery pack 1 is not mounted on an external host device or when the external host device is not driven by a battery, the main battery pack 1 is transferred from the main battery pack 1 by a predetermined capacity to the auxiliary battery pack 6 as shown in FIG. After discharging, the battery is charged by the same capacity, and the remaining impedance is corrected by calculating the internal impedance Ri and the open circuit voltage Vo using the following formula based on the voltages Vc, Vd, currents Ic, Id at the time of charging and discharging. I do.

Ri = (Vc−Vd) / (Ic + Id) Vo = Vd + Ri × Id or Vo = Vc−Ri × I
c In the calculation of the open circuit voltage, Vo = Vc−
Calculate using Ri × Ic to obtain a part of the open circuit voltage waveform (to avoid inaccurate open circuit voltage due to polarization). Then, based on the reference open circuit voltage waveform, the voltage value and the inclination angle are compared to obtain the current discharge capacity, and this is subtracted from the full charge to calculate the current capacity value. When the main battery pack 1 discharges to an external host device, if the remaining battery capacity of the main battery pack 1 does not exceed the correction capacity even if the cell voltage of the main battery pack 1 falls below a predetermined voltage, the auxiliary battery pack Then, the main battery pack 1 is charged from 6 to match the apparent capacity value with the actual capacity value.

When the main battery pack 1 is charged from an external charger, pulse charging is performed between a charge start voltage and a charge stop voltage, and when the charge stop voltage is reached, the main battery pack 1 is instantaneously assisted by the main battery pack 1. Discharge to battery pack 6. This is because when the charging voltage reaches a predetermined charging stop voltage and the charging is temporarily stopped, the charge amount stored in the capacitor of the equivalent circuit of the voltage drop due to the polarization shown in FIG.
Charge OFF until it drops to the charge start voltage as shown in
In order to shorten the time, the amount of charge stored in the capacitor of the equivalent circuit of the voltage drop due to the polarization is instantaneously discharged to the auxiliary battery pack 6 and set to 0.
As shown in FIG. 6B, the charging time can be reduced.
